Multiple industries depend on tension load cells for operations requiring precise force measurement and continuous monitoring. Manufacturing facilities utilize these sensors for quality assurance, production line supervision, and equipment protection systems. The construction industry relies on them for crane safety mechanisms, structural evaluation, and material handling applications. Logistics and transportation companies integrate tension load cells into weighing systems, cargo management, and vehicle safety protocols. Research institutions, aerospace operations, and maritime installations also employ these precision instruments for testing, development, and safety measures across various applications.
